// WithAfter - offset identifier to start pagination from as returned by the 'next' field in the response body..
func (f SnapshotGet) WithAfter(v string)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.After = v
}
}
// WithFromSortValue - value of the current sort column at which to start retrieval..
func (f SnapshotGet) WithFromSortValue(v string)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.FromSortValue = v
}
}
// WithIgnoreUnavailable - whether to ignore unavailable snapshots, defaults to false which means a snapshotmissingexception is thrown.
func (f SnapshotGet) WithIgnoreUnavailable(v bool)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.IgnoreUnavailable = &v
}
}
// WithIncludeRepository - whether to include the repository name in the snapshot info. defaults to true..
func (f SnapshotGet) WithIncludeRepository(v bool)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.IncludeRepository = &v
}
}
// WithIndexDetails - whether to include details of each index in the snapshot, if those details are available. defaults to false..
func (f SnapshotGet) WithIndexDetails(v bool)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.IndexDetails = &v
}
}
// WithIndexNames - whether to include the name of each index in the snapshot. defaults to true..
func (f SnapshotGet) WithIndexNames(v bool)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.IndexNames = &v
}
}
// WithMasterTimeout - explicit operation timeout for connection to master node.
func (f SnapshotGet) WithMasterTimeout(v time.Duration)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.MasterTimeout = v
}
}
// WithOffset - numeric offset to start pagination based on the snapshots matching the request. defaults to 0.
func (f SnapshotGet) WithOffset(v int)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.Offset = &v
}
}
// WithOrder - sort order.
func (f SnapshotGet) WithOrder(v string)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.Order = v
}
}
// WithSize - maximum number of snapshots to return. defaults to 0 which means return all that match without limit..
func (f SnapshotGet) WithSize(v int)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.Size = &v
}
}
// WithSlmPolicyFilter - filter snapshots by a list of slm policy names that snapshots belong to. accepts wildcards. use the special pattern '_none' to match snapshots without an slm policy.
func (f SnapshotGet) WithSlmPolicyFilter(v string)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.SlmPolicyFilter = v
}
}
// WithSort - allows setting a sort order for the result. defaults to start_time.
func (f SnapshotGet) WithSort(v string)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.Sort = v
}
}
// WithVerbose - whether to show verbose snapshot info or only show the basic info found in the repository index blob.
func (f SnapshotGet) WithVerbose(v bool) func(*SnapshotGetRequest) {
return func(r *SnapshotGetRequest) {
r.Verbose = &v
}
}
